Most Danish high-rise buildings were built in the 1950s through the 1970s in the country's construction boom. Some examples are Bellahøj from the 50s, Høje Gladsaxe from the 60s and Boligbebyggelsen Brøndby Strand from the 70s, all of these located in the Copenhagen Metropolitan Area. Since then, only a few towers have been built.
